In this episode, I explore the work and ideas of Amy Chua.

Amy is not only a tenured Professor of Law at Yale University, she is also a bestselling author of several books. Her most famous books was published in 2011 and is called "The Battle Hymn of the Tiger Mother."

Amy told me that she was a huge fan of Thomas Sowell but what I didn’t know at the time is that Thomas Sowell is also a huge fan of Amy Chua.

Find out why in this episode, as I explore Amy's ideas about political tribalism and why some groups succeed more than others, a theme which is right up Sowell Alley.

Amy just wrote her first novel called "The Golden Gate," which I highly recommend you read. Here are her other, non-fiction books:

2002: World On Fire: How Exporting Free Market Democracy Breeds Ethnic Hatred and Global Instability.

2007: Day of Empire: How Hyperpowers Rise to Global Dominance – and Why They Fall.

2011: Battle Hymn of the Tiger Mother.

2014: The Triple Package: How Three Unlikely Traits Explain the Rise and Fall of Cultural Groups in America.

2018: Political Tribes: Group Instinct and the Fate of Nations.
